Urgent Early Pregnancy Guidance

When to book an ectopic pregnancy scan — and when to seek emergency care

A private ectopic pregnancy ultrasound can be helpful when you need a rapid early-pregnancy location assessment, but some symptoms should not wait for a private appointment.

Book a same-day scan if

  • You have a positive pregnancy test and want to confirm the pregnancy location.
  • You are around 5–6 weeks pregnant or uncertain about dates.
  • You have mild pelvic discomfort or spotting and need reassurance.
  • You have a previous ectopic pregnancy or risk factors and need early assessment.

Do not wait for a private scan if

  • Severe or worsening one-sided pelvic pain.
  • Heavy bleeding, fainting, dizziness, collapse or feeling very unwell.
  • Shoulder-tip pain or severe abdominal pain.
  • Known pregnancy with acute symptoms. Call 999 or attend A&E immediately.
Clinical Pathway

What happens during an ectopic pregnancy ultrasound?

1. Clinical history

We ask about dates, pregnancy test, pain, bleeding, previous ectopic pregnancy, IVF treatment, contraception history and any urgent symptoms.

2. Ultrasound assessment

The scan assesses the uterus, endometrium, pregnancy sac location, ovaries, adnexa/tubes and any free fluid in the pelvis.

3. Clear next steps

If the pregnancy location is not clear, or if findings are concerning, the report will advise repeat scan, blood tests, GP, Early Pregnancy Unit or emergency referral as appropriate.

Common Questions

Frequently asked questions

When should an ectopic pregnancy scan be done?

Usually from around 5–6 weeks, when an intrauterine pregnancy can typically be confirmed. If symptoms are severe, emergency assessment is essential rather than a routine scan.

What are the warning signs of an ectopic pregnancy?

Severe or one-sided pelvic pain, heavy bleeding, shoulder-tip pain, dizziness or fainting. These require emergency medical care immediately — call 999 or attend A&E.

Can the scan always find an ectopic pregnancy?

Very early on, the location may not be clear and repeat scans or blood tests may be needed. Your report will advise on next steps and any urgent referral.
